Major Caine,
We have again been applied to by the Colonial Treasurer for a year's rent upon Lots 147 & 163, belonging to Mr Alexander Matheson.
We would apologize for not at once paying the Treasurer's demand, but are induced to defer it while requesting your perusal of the enclosed copy of a letter which we had the honor to address to you on the 27th September 1847 upon the subject.
